About Deborah Lindquist

Deborah Lindquist is a scholar working on Oncology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Cancer Research, Dermatology and Molecular Biology, having authored 26 papers that have together received 3.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HER2/EGFR in Cancer Research (10 papers), Cancer Treatment and Pharmacology (8 papers), Advanced Breast Cancer Therapies (6 papers), Breast Cancer Treatment Studies (6 papers), Chemotherapy-related skin toxicity (3 papers),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(3 papers), Lung Cancer Research Studies (2 papers) and Estrogen and related hormone effects (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Oncology (2.3k citations), Cancer Research (565 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(634 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(787 citations) and Genetics (226 citations). Deborah Lindquist has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and France. Frequent co-authors include David Cameron, Agnieszka Jagiełło-Gruszfeld, Mario Campone, Neville Davidson, Dimosthenis Skarlos, Mark S. Berger, Tadeusz Pieńkowski, Arlene Chan, Charles E. Geyer and Stephen D. Rubin.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Cancer Research, The Lancet Oncology, European Journal of Cancer and Breast Cancer Research and Treatment.
